To address unfair and wrongful dismissal in Zambia, there are several remedies available to employees. Wrongful dismissal has been held to be illegal dismissal for want of following due/correct procedure (Phiri v Bank of Zambia (198/2005) [2007] ZMSC 21 (20 August 2007)).
